Chase Elliott ties slew of drivers on wins list

Photo by Jonathan Fjeld/TRE

LINCOLN, Ala. — Chase Elliott’s victory in the Yellawood 500 Sunday at Talladega Superspeedway marked his 18th career NASCAR Cup Series points-awarding victory.

The win now ties Elliott with Geoff Bodine, Neil Bonnett, Harry Gant, Kasey Kahne, Hendrick Motorsports teammate Kyle Larson, and Ryan Newman for 47th all-time on the wins list.

Elliott said he didn’t know he had tied with his teammate Larson, and former Hendrick drivers Bodine and Kahne, but thought the mark was “cool.”

“It’s kinda hard to believe,” Elliott said to The Racing Experts. “18. One was hard. To have 18 now, it’s special. Would love to keep adding to it but as time goes on.

“I’m proud of our team. It’s been the same tem with some changes in there but Alan (Gufstason, crew chief), Tom (Gray, engineer), Eddie (D’Hondt, spotter) have been there the whole way. Proud we’ve been able to grow and have that many opportunities to grab checkered flags.”

The next drivers ahead of Elliott and crew at 19 wins include Davey Allison, Buddy Baker, Greg Biffle, and Fonty Flock.

Elliott has reached Victory Lane five times in 2022 — the most among the Cup Series competition. Prior to the start of the season, Elliott was tied for 58th on the wins list.

The next race for the NASCAR Cup Series is scheduled for next Sunday, Oct. 9, at the Charlotte Road Course.
